Road cycling routes around Kienberg traverse a varied landscape featuring passes, river valleys, and rolling hills. The region offers routes that navigate through both natural scenery and areas with historical towns. Elevations vary, providing diverse challenges for cyclists. The terrain includes ascents to passes and descents through forested areas.

Are there road cycling routes suitable for beginners in Kienberg?

Yes, Kienberg has several road cycling routes suitable for beginners. There are 49 easy routes available, such as the View of the Sissle River – Forest Picnic Area loop from Gipf-Oberfrick, which is 14.0 miles (22.5 km) long and leads through river valleys and forested areas.

Are there challenging road cycling routes for experienced riders in Kienberg?

Absolutely. For experienced riders seeking a challenge, Kienberg offers 73 difficult routes. An example is the View of Sissacher Flue – Way to the Top of Olsberg loop from Wegenstetten, a 40.5 km route with significant elevation gain, providing a demanding ride through varied terrain.

Can I find circular road cycling routes in Kienberg?

Yes, many of the road cycling routes in Kienberg are designed as loops, allowing you to start and end at the same point. For instance, the Benkerjoch Pass – Benkerjoch South Ascent loop from Wölflinswil is a moderate 23.7 km circular route with a notable climb.

What natural attractions can I see along the road cycling routes in Kienberg?

Along the road cycling routes, you can discover various natural attractions. Highlights include the Rünenberger Giessen and Giessen Waterfall, as well as the Wasserflue Waterfall and Bärenloch (Bear’s Hole) Cave. The region also features natural monuments like the Gislifluh/Gisliflue summit.
